An 18th century cottage nestled within Pembrokeshire, close to spectacular sea views..
All on the Ground Floor: Living room: Freeview TV, French Doors Leading To Garden Dining room.
Kitchen: Electric Cooker, Microwave, Fridge/Freezer, Washer Dryer Bedroom 1: Double (4ft 6in) Bed Bedroom 2: 2 x Single (3ft) Beds Bathroom: Roll Top Bath, Walk-In Shower, Toilet.
Oil central heating (£15 per week October-April), electricity, bed linen and towels included.
Travel cot and highchair available on request.
Enclosed garden with patio, terrace and garden furniture.
Private parking for 1 car.
No smoking.
Please note: There area 9 uneven steps to narrow unfenced terrace.
Take care with small children..
A gem of a small 18th century Pembrokeshire holiday cottage in a cliff top location.
Above the harbour coastal footpath with some spectacular sea views as it winds its way around the headland to Parrot Beach and onto the Pembrokeshire Coastal Path.
The cottage has been lovingly renovated and furnished with a pleasing blend of modern and antique pieces.
French doors open from the living room onto a pretty cottage garden, on several levels, with panoramic views over the picturesque harbour and quay at Lower Town - ’Under Milk Wood’ and ’Moby Dick’ were both filmed here.
A great location for your holiday - walk to the harbour, beach, coastal path, and town.
Children must be supervised on site due to possible safety hazards.
There are steps to external facilities.
Towels provided, you need cot linen if required.

A delightful 18th century cottage, full of character, unique position on the Coast Path yet in a town, with a garden to catch the sun all day. You can walk to pubs, shops, waterfront, etc. Books, games, children's toys are exceptional. Big need-to-know: there is no wi-fi. We loved it.
